Pyramids of Giza Complex

The complex consists of three major pyramids, six small pyramids, the Great Sphinx, and the Valley Temple. The structure was built during the 4th dynasty, 2400 years ago.

The Great Pyramid of Giza

The Great Pyramid belonged to “King Khufu.” It is the oldest and biggest of the three pyramids on the Giza plateau, and the only one of the Seven Wonders of the Ancient World to have survived intact. The enormous pyramid is 147 meters tall, was erected with 2,300,000 stones, and took twenty years to complete.

Sphinx of Giza

The Great Sphinx is the biggest statue in the world, reaching 73 meters long, 19 meters broad, and 20 meters tall. It belongs to “King Chephren.” It is the world’s oldest monumental sculpture.

The Temple of the Valley

The sole extant granite funerary temple used by Ancient Egyptians for mummification on the Giza plateau.

Step Pyramid of Saqqara

It is said to be the first large-scale cut stone building, dating back to King Djoser’s reign in Egypt in the 27th century B.C. The Saqqara step pyramid is composed of six steps constructed atop one another and is 62 meters tall.

Memphis City

It was King Menes’s first capital in Egypt, and it maintained a strategic location between Upper and Lower Egypt. Memphis was said to be guarded by the deity Ptah, the god of creation and art.

The Egyptian Museum

The Egyptian Museum has a remarkable collection of art dating back 5000 years. Nearly 250,000 authentic ancient Egyptian items are on display, including an exhibit devoted to King Tutankhamen’s wealth, gold, and jewelry collection, which was kept in his tomb for over 3,500 years.

Citadel of Salah El Din

Salah El Din Citadel is a majestic fortification that served as Egypt’s center of government until the 1860s. It was built under the reign of Salah ad-Din. The building began in 1176 and was finished in 1182.

Mosque of Mohamed Ali

The mosque was titled “The Alabaster Mosque” because the majority of the walls were composed of pure alabaster and were built between 1830 and 1848. The Mohamed Ali Mosque is a copy of Istanbul’s Blue Mosque.

The National Museum of Egyptian Civilization

The National Museum of Egyptian Civilization (NMEC) is a heavenly doorway leading to Egypt’s everlasting treasures that date back more than 4000 years and were discovered on the hallowed land of El Fustat in ancient Cairo, Egypt’s first capital during the commencement of the Islamic period.

Bazaar Khan El Khalili

Your luxury vacation in Egypt would be incomplete without a visit to Khan El-Khalili Bazaar, the oldest and most renowned in the Middle East. It was built around 970 AD, the same year Cairo was founded.

High Dam of Aswan

It was erected over the Nile River at Aswan between 1960 and 1970, and it has had a tremendous impact on Egypt’s economy and culture.

The Unfinished Obelisk

The old world’s biggest obelisk. It was commissioned by Queen Hatshepsut (1508-1458 BC) to accompany the Lateran Obelisk (originally at Karnak) and was eventually moved to the Lateran Palace in Rome.

Temple of Philae

The temple of Philae is devoted to the goddess Isis of Love and Beauty. As part of the UNESCO Nubia Campaign initiative, the temple complex was demolished and transported to neighboring Agilkia Island, preserving it and other monuments before the installation of the Aswan High Dam in 1970.

Temples of Abu Simbel

The two Temples of Abu Simbel, with their distinct architecture, are regarded as ancient Egypt’s greatest. The Temples are rock-cut temples created during King Ramses II’s reign around 1200 B.C. The first temple is dedicated to King Ramses II, and the second to his loving wife Queen Nefertari. The sculptures and artwork that adorn both temples are breathtaking. This temple has hand-carved pillars, wall murals, sculptures, statues, and much more.

Temple of Kom Ombo

The Nile is seen from the Kom Ombo Temple. This temple is split into two temples, each having two entrances, two hypostyle halls, and two sanctuaries.

Temple of Edfu

Dedicated to Horus, the Egyptian god. Edfu Temple is Egypt’s best intact Greco-Roman temple, with a “Play” depicting Horus’ victory over the wicked deity Seth on its walls.

Temple of Karnak

There is no more spectacular location in Egypt than Karnak, which is one of the top Egypt tourist sites. It is the greatest temple complex ever constructed by man and marks the culmination of many generations of ancient builders and Pharaohs. Karnak Temple consists of three major temples, many smaller enclosed temples, and several outside temples spread over 247 acres of land.

The Valley of Kings

It is the ultimate resting place of Egypt’s kings from the 18th to the 20th dynasties, and it contains tombs of pharaohs such as Ramses II and Tutankhamen. The tombs were well-stocked with all the material items that a monarch may want in the afterlife. The majority of the ornamentation within the graves has survived.

Temple of Hatshepsut

It is one of the most stunning and well-preserved Ancient Egyptian temples. The temple was erected on three levels, with two large ramps connecting them in the center.

Memnon’s Colossi

The sole remnants of a full funerary temple are two huge stone sculptures of King Amenhotep III. The sculptures are built from pieces of quartzite sandstone found in Cairo and transported 700 kilometers to Luxor.
